在网站上使用 Surface Pro 触控笔

Using the Surface Pro pen on websites

本文关键字:Pro Surface 网站      更新时间:2023-09-26

MS Surface Pro上的手写笔非常好,尤其是在OneNote中。对于工程师和设计师来说,它使草图和线框图变得超级简单。

另一方面,OneNote 的在线功能相当有限,我可以想到 Web 应用程序中良好手写笔的许多其他用途。

有没有办法,或者更好的现有库,在 JavaScript 中复制 OneNote 的触笔行为(例如手掌拒绝、平滑线条、擦除笔触等(以便在浏览器中使用?

编辑:需要明确的是,我的意思不仅仅是在MS Office上的基本绘图,更像是MS Office中的墨迹书写功能,您可以在文档内容上徒手绘制,而不会干扰您与应用程序的交互方式,并且当您滚动和缩放时,墨水保持不变。

我设想某种全屏透明画布,当检测到笔悬停时出现,并在移开笔以允许常规鼠标输入时隐藏。内容将被传达到某种SVG并显示位置:相对;什么的。

这在原始HTML5中是可能的吗,或者我正在寻找某种插件?

指针事件草案规范提供了编写这样一个库所需的原语,但不幸的是,Chrome团队投票反对支持它,它是否会成为一个足够支持的标准,可以在公共网站上使用还有待观察。